Indeed we (tegra) have just been hit by this. The problem seems to come 
from the fact that we have been using drm_vblank_pre_modeset, 
drm_vblank_post_modeset and drm_vblank_off conjointly. All these 
functions depend on the value of vblank->inmodeset, and 7ffd7a68511 
increases the vblank reference counter only in drm_vblank_off, which can 
result in the acquired reference never being released.

The following seems to fix this for Tegra, by stopping using 
drm_vblank_pre/post_modeset and relying on drm_vblank_off/on instead:

There's no effect on user applications if the driver behaves properly.
As far as I can tell, every driver that calls drm_vblank_off() but not
drm_vblank_on() will break. You can easily test this by running libdrm
modetest -s ... -v, which instead of toggling between the test pattern
and an all-gray framebuffer will switch to the gray one once and then
hang.

I guess that was probably not intended, but according to the new rules
all these drivers have now become buggy. So before merging this patch I
think we need to fix existing drivers to avoid regressions.

It shouldn't happen. If drm_vblank_off() and drm_vblank_on() are called
around a modeset they should never conflict with drm_vblank_get(), at
least on Tegra, because the modeset and page-flip IOCTLs will be
serialized.
